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Trainee teacher of computer science

Great Yarmouth
Internship
Teaching Vacancies
Training teacher
€30,000 a year
Posted: 14h ago
Offer description

What skills and experience we're looking for

Essential Qualifications:

* Educated to degree level or equivalent and able to teach on a range of courses within the subject area
* GCSE Maths & English at grade C or above (or equivalent Level 2 qualifications).


What the school offers its staff


Benefits:

* Canteen
* Cycle to work scheme
* Free flu jabs
* Free parking
* Health & wellbeing programme
* On-site gym
* On-site parking
* Sick pay


Further details about the role


Key purpose of role:

This training position is offered to support the development of the quality of education in the College. The primary of the focus will be to develop the skills required for the teaching of a specific subject, but the trainee will be required to cover other subjects according to College needs.

During the period of training, the post holder will be offered the opportunity to gain valuable in‑class experience as the lead teacher for a specified number of classes, alongside bespoke training, combined with offering additional cover teaching in the remainder of the contracted time. The balance between leading learning and supporting classes with shift through the course of the training period for this post.

The post holder will be expected to gain an initial L3 T&L qualification in the first year and a L5 qualification in the second and third years. There will also be a specified block of training for postholders to allow for CPD supporting their teaching.

Balance of teaching and training will change according to the skills, knowledge and any experience but until the trainee has completed Level 5 qualifications, there is an expectation that they will be full‑time but will have at least one block of training in which to prepare their materials. Blocks of cover will be organised depending on teaching load and the requirements of the individual and College.

To maintain and develop high standards of teaching and learning in the delivery of the courses for which the staff member is responsible. The postholder will plan and deliver high quality effective teaching and learning and professional and caring support, enabling students to enjoy learning and achieve their full potential.

To undertake the professional duties of a teacher in accordance with this job description and the DfE Professional Teachers’ Standards. To supervise and deliver prepared lessons and tutorials in the absence of a teacher to ensure learning and development is continued.


Commitment to safeguarding

Our organisation is committed to safeguarding and promoting the welfare of children, young people and vulnerable adults. We expect all staff, volunteers and trustees to share this commitment. Our recruitment process follows the keeping children safe in education guidance.

Offers of employment may be subject to the following checks (where relevant): childcare disqualification Disclosure and Barring Service (DBS) medical online and social media prohibition from teaching right to work satisfactory references suitability to work with children You must tell us about any unspent conviction, cautions, reprimands or warnings under the Rehabilitation of Offenders Act 1974 (Exceptions) Order 1975.

#J-18808-Ljbffr

Apply
Create E-mail Alert
Job alert activated
Saved
Save
See more jobs
Similar jobs
Education jobs in Great Yarmouth
jobs Great Yarmouth
jobs Norfolk
jobs England
Home > Jobs > Education jobs > Training teacher jobs > Training teacher jobs in Great Yarmouth > Trainee Teacher of Computer Science

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2025 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save